Three core components make up any high‑performing bingo plan at Foxwood: card coverage, pattern timing, and bankroll stewardship. Card coverage means selecting enough tickets to increase the chance that a called number appears on at least one of them. Pattern timing involves focusing on the most frequently drawn shapes such as four‑corners or a straight line. Finally, bankroll stewardship ensures you wager amounts that let you stay in the game long enough to reap the statistical edge.
